Cooking Instructions
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Baked Chicken Parmesan Casserole:
Step 1: Preheat Your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Spray a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per on both sides.
Step 2: Sauté That Garlic
In a skillet over medium heat, add olive oil and sauté minced garlic until fragrant—about one minute. Keep an eye on it; burnt garlic is not our friend!
Step 3: Layer It Up
In your prepared baking dish, layer the chicken breasts at the bottom. Pour marinara sauce generously over them until they are well-coated.
Step 4: Add Cheese Galore
S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ese evenly over the marinara-covered chicken like you’re creating a cheesy masterpiece. It’s okay to be generous here; nobody ever complained about too much cheese!
Step 5: The Crunch Factor
In a small bowl, mix grated Parmesan cheese and Italian breadcrumbs together. Sprinkle this mixture over the top layer of cheese for added crunch and flavor.
Step 6: Bake to Perfection
Cover your baking dish with aluminum foil (shiny side facing in) and bake for about 25 minutes. After that, remove the foil and bake for another 15-20 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.
Transfer to plates and drizzle with some extra marinara sauce for the perfect finishing touch!

Storing & Reheating
Store any leftovers of your Baked Chicken Parmesan Casserole in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, simply pop it back in the oven at 350°F until warmed through, ensuring it retains its delightful texture.

Baked Chicken Parmesan Casserole
- Total Time: 1 hour
- Yield: Serves approximately 6 people 1x
Description
Baked Chicken Parmesan Casserole is a comforting dish that combines tender chicken, zesty marinara sauce, and melted cheese for a delightful family meal. This easy-to-make casserole captures the essence of Italian cuisine in one hearty dish, perfect for weeknight dinners or festive gatherings. With layers of flavor and texture, it’s sure to impress everyone at your table!
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(approximately 1.5 lbs)
- 3 cloves fresh garlic, minced
- 2 cups marinara sauce (store-bought or homemade)
- 2 cups shredded whole milk mozzarella cheese
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- ½ cup Italian breadcrumbs (or panko for extra crunch)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2 tbsp olive oil
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Spray a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ray and season chicken breasts with salt and pepper.
- In a skillet over medium heat, add olive oil and sauté minced garlic until fragrant (about one minute).
- Layer seasoned chicken in the prepared baking dish and cover with marinara sauce.
- Sprinkle mozzarella cheese generously over the sauce.
- In a small bowl, mix grated Parmesan and breadcrumbs; sprinkle over the cheese layer.
- Cover with aluminum foil and bake for 25 minutes. Remove foil and bake an additional 15-20 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.
